FreeRDP is a free implementation of the Remote Desktop Protocol (RDP). Prior to version 2.7.0, server side authentication against a SAM
file might be successful for invalid credentials if the server has configured an invalid SAM
file path. FreeRDP based clients are not affected. RDP server implementations using FreeRDP to authenticate against a SAM
file are affected. Version 2.7.0 contains a fix for this issue. As a workaround, use custom authentication via HashCallback
and/or ensure the SAM
database path configured is valid and the application has file handles left.
